- People with circulation problems, the most well-known perhaps being varicose veins, benefit from fish oil.
- Omega-3 fatty acids have been shown to reduce symptoms of ADHD in children (Attention Deficit Hyperactive Disorder).
- Some children have had improved academic performance when they have previously struggled to learn with omega 3 supplementation.
- There have also been animal studies that have suggested that omega 3s might help with decrease memory loss of people who are older
- Omega 3 fatty acids have been found to have an anti-inflammatory property that can help with neck pain, rheumatoid arthritis
- Some studies have shown that there is a deficit in omega-3 fatty acids in many people with depression, and other studies have shown that omega-3 supplementation reduced symptoms.

Omega 3 fatty acids
Omega-3 fatty acids are an essential nutrient, meaning that they are required for normal growth in children. However, it is the benefit to adults that has received more attention lately. The following benefits have been found (please contact the author for reference information):
